SANTA ANA - The Dons couldn't have faced a tougher opponent to open their 2012 season then the defending state champions from Riverside City College and it showed in the pool as the visiting Tigers handed the Dons a 21-3 loss in their Orange Empire Conference opener.
After Riverside opened leads of 9-0 in the first quarter and 16-0 at the half, the scoring slowed down as the Tigers managed just three goals in the third. The Dons got on the board in the fourth quarter with two goals from Jasmin Pannier and the third from Nikole Facklam.
Riverside scored one goal during the Dons three-goal spurt before scoring the final goal with just over one minute left in the game to make the final score 21-3.
